Output 1959a0f576607697faef266e6e7cd0f153a1ab77e09b3fa217fe2e14f2cb369f:34

value
409674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3880c3d1c4663afd5daa99855418a69c657e96f OP_EQUAL
address
3NS6HrdzTvx5WbEhv5V2CFrktU2zLf58yg
transaction
1959a0f576607697faef266e6e7cd0f153a1ab77e09b3fa217fe2e14f2cb369f
spent
true